p.3 The Lego NXT NXT Servo Motor Light Sensor Touch Sensor Ultrasonic Sensor Sound Sensor

Servo Motor Allow robot to move Could move forward, backward, left, right, and in degrees and in degrees

Sensors Light sensor could identify light

Touch sensor allow robot to feel things

Ultrasonic sensor allow robot to see things

Sound sensor allow robot to hear

The brain of the robot, allow robot to run program
